OMER T. GILLETTE, assistant to the chair of surgery and secretary of the medical faculty, a resident of Iowa City; was born June 28, 1845, at Terre Haute, Indiana. He was a soldier in the late civil war, serving in company D, 132d Regiment Indiana Volunteer Infantry. He graduated from the State University of Indiana, in 1866; he received the honor of his class; he attended lectures at the Medical College at Ann Arbor, Michigan, in the winter of 1867 and ‘68, and graduated from the College of Physicians and Surgeons 01 New York city, March 1, 1869; he practiced his profession three years in Chicago, six years in La Salle, Illinois, and then settled in Iowa City in 1878, and was elected to his present position in the State University, in 1879, as secretary of the medical faculty. He was married September 26, 1871, to Miss Mary A. Brokenshire, of Boston, Massachusetts. A republican in politics. He is a member of the M. E. Church, Beta Theta Pi, A. 0. U. W. of Iowa City, and L. of H. Obituary, Colorado Springs Gazette, Saturday, Oct. 6, 1894 page 5:1:

"Dr. Omar T. Gillett died in this city yesterday at the age of 49 years. Death resulted from hemorrhage of the lungs and was sudden, although the doctor had been an invalid for many years. His wife was assisting him to dress at the time. Dr. Gillett's death will be learned with regret by everyone who has known him. About 10 years ago his health failed and he came here and since that time he has been a great sufferer. Although his sufferings were intense they were borne patiently and uncomplainingly and his life has been an inspiration to all who knew him. So all, that he could not leave like house most of the time yet he drew to him a host of friends by his noble qualities of mind and heart. Dr. Gillett was a native of Indiana and served through the war. He graduated at the College of Physicians and Surgeons in New York in 18__ (1870?). He was rapidly acquiring a high place in the profesion when stricken with the disease which terminated his professional career and ______ his life. Dr. Gillett came here from Iowa City, Ia., where he occupied one of the chairs in the State University. He was especially skillfull as a surgeon. Since coming here the doctor has done considerable literary work and with much success. Dr. Gillett's family consists of his wife, three sons and a daughter, all of them nearly grown. Obituary; Gazette Telegraph; Monday July 19, 1948 page 1 & 3:

"Dr. Gillett, City Health Officer, Dies

"Dr. Omer Rand Gillett, pioneer health leader and medical authority of the state, who had been a resident of Colorado Springs for 62 years, died at a local hospital this morning, following an illnes of several weeks. He was 74 years of age. Dr. Gillett was city health officer for 39 years. He was intensely interested in public health problems, placing stress on prevention and keeping abreast of developments in the medical world. He built the Colorado Springs health department into one of the most outstanding in the country. His interest in health and sanitation was instrumental in raising and maintaining standards for milk and domestic water. He gave unceasingly both of his finances and his time to raise the health standards of this community.

"SERVED IN MEDICAL CORPS IN WAR I

"Dr. Gillett held the post of director of public health and sanitation continuously since 1909 with the exception of 15 months during World War I when he was stationed at the Army Medical school in Washington, D.C. While here he met many national celebrities including Robert Lansing, secretary of state in the Woodrow Wilson administration; Ty cobb, one of the greatest baseball players of all time; Branen Rickey, baseball magnate and Eddie Rickenbacker, noted race driver in World War ace aviator. Retired as a captain in the medical corps, in 1919, Dr. Gillett returned to Colorado Springs to resume his work here and again played a leading role in improvement of health conditions in the city and county, particularly in prevention and treatment of diseases in the schools.

"Under Dr. Gillett's regime, the nursing department was added to the health department and changes were made to methods of handling contagious diseases. He was instrumental in the builidng of the contagious disease hospital by the city in 1917, and the county isolation hospital in Bear Creek canon. The son of a physician, he was born November 2, 1874 in La Salle, Ill. He moved with his family to Iowa city, Ia., when he was a small child. The family came to Colorado Springs in February 1888.

"MEMBER OF FIRST FOOTBALL TEAM

"Omer R. Gillett attended public school here and at the age of 17 was a member of the first High school football team organized in the city. He was graduated in 1893 in the first class to be graduated from the senior high school. He then attended Colorado College and was a member of the first Tiger basketball squad, organized in 1897. He was graduated from Colorado College in 1898. As a youth he packed burros in the resort hotel on the south slope of Pikes Peak, operated by Everett and Paul Curtis, located on a claim that included Hart Lake, now known as municipal reservoir No. 5. Burros loaded with supplies, were guided from Colorado Springs to the hotel by Gillett over a trail thru Bear Creek canon. At that time carriages reached the hotel over the old Cheyenne Toll road which later became the Cripple Creek stage road. The log hotel, which was fazed years ago, was a favorite starting place, for persons making the trip to the summit of Pikes Peak by burro.

"After his graduation from Colorado College, Gillett attended the University of Iowa to study medicine. After two years there he entered Jefferson Medical college at Philadelphia where he received his M.D. degree in 1902. For a year he was interne at Jefferson college hospital and then returned to Colorado Springs to enter private practice in 1903.
A man who was always interested in his fellowmen, Dr. Gillett was active in many organizations and had life interests outside the medical profession, ranging to church, sports and philanthropic work. He was a member of the medical staff of Glockner, St. Francis and Beth-El now Memorial hospital; was a past president of the El Paso County medical society, past president of the Solly Tuberculosis society; the Colorado Medical socieity and the American Medical Association. He also belonged to the Colorado Springs Clinical club, the American Health Association and was a past president of the Jefferson Medical alumnar.

"In civic interests he was first president of the Colorado Springs Kiwanis club and the third district governor of the Kiwanis club of Colorado and Wyoming. He was past vice president of of the Winter Night Club, a member of the El Paso club, past exaited ruler of the Elks lodge and past commander of the American Legion. He was a director of the YMCA and a member of Beta Theta Pi fraternity, and belonged to the Methodist church.

"Active in Masonic circles, Dr. Gillett was a member of AF and AM No. 104 was past commander of Knights Templar, and was knight commander of the court of honor, the next highest rank above the 32nd degree Masons. Dr. Gillett made his home at the El Paso club.

FLETCHER WILLAM (sic) G0RDON: Physician & Surgeon; b Fletcher, Ontario Mar 7. 1877; s of William Fletcher-Elizabeth ___; ed Toronto, Canada, MB 1899; m Mira Stonebraker 1905 Royal; s William G, Robert Bruce: d Isabel (Mrs Donald Reid); in prac with brother David more than 30 years, the two are known as "Doc Gordon" & "Doc Dave"; Gordon, elder of the bros, ent prac in Orchard upon completIng med sch; began in the horse & buggy days when there were only trails & walked, rode a horse, used a buggy or wagon; performed operations in sod houses on kitchen tables; has helped make wills in absence of a lawyer, has prepared the dead for burial & made arrangements for funerals when no undertaker was available; he and brother have operated with physicians in Holt, Antelope, Knox Cos; during past 10 years brothers have delivered over 4000 babies & have performed over 1000 major operations; AF&AM; hobby, farming; res Orchard. Almost as old a resident is Dr. G. W. Fletcher, who came to Orchard forty years ago, and who has practiced there since. He was joined later by his brother Dr. D. L. Fletcher who has practiced with him more than thirty years. Orchard has never had any other physicians.
  
"Doc Gordon," as a youth in his twenties, performed his first major operation--an appendectomy upon a homesteader living in a sod house. The kitchen table served as an operating table and there was no assisting nurse. Forty years later Dr. Fletcher operated upon the same man in the Orchard hospital. J. W.
